VWO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2025 in Review

2,301 of the 7,620 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vanguard FTSE Emerging Markets ETF (VWO) for Q3 2025, worth a combined $72.9B — up 11% from $65.5B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 149 funds opened new VWO positions and 67 closed out — a net gain of 82 holders — while 1,049 added to existing stakes and 840 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Northwestern Mutual Wealth Management, adding an estimated $166M. The largest seller was Envestnet Asset Management, cutting an estimated $396M.
